linux通过命令行连接wifi

worktile 其他 700

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要通过命令行连接WiFi,首先需要确保你的Linux系统已经安装了所需的无线网卡驱动程序。

    以下是连接WiFi的步骤:

    1. 打开终端:在Linux系统中,你可以通过按下Ctrl+Alt+T快捷键来打开终端。

    2. 扫描可用的WiFi网络:在终端中,使用以下命令扫描附近的WiFi网络:“`
    sudo iwlist wlan0 scan
    “`
    这里的`wlan0`是你的无线网卡接口名称,可以根据实际情况进行更改。

    3. 查看扫描结果:扫描结果将列出附近的WiFi网络,包括它们的SSID(网络名称)。找到你想连接的WiFi网络,记下它的SSID。

    4. 连接WiFi网络:使用以下命令连接WiFi网络:
    “`
    sudo nmcli d wifi connect password “`
    将``替换为你要连接的WiFi网络的SSID,``替换为WiFi网络的密码。如果WiFi网络没有密码,则不需要输入密码。

    5. 等待连接完成:连接过程可能需要一些时间,一旦连接成功,终端会显示连接成功的信息。

    6. 检查连接状态:使用以下命令检查WiFi连接状态:
    “`
    nmcli d
    “`
    在输出结果中,你应该能看到你的无线网卡以及它所连接的WiFi网络。

    这就是通过命令行连接WiFi的步骤。记住,具体的命令可能会因为不同的Linux发行版而有所差异,你需要根据自己的系统做相应的调整。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以通过命令行的方式连接WiFi网络。下面是在不同的Linux发行版中连接WiFi网络的方法:

    1. Ubuntu或Debian系统:
    打开终端,并输入以下命令来查看可用的无线网络列表:
    “`
    sudo iwlist scan
    “`

    在列表中找到你要连接的WiFi网络的名称(SSID)。

    然后,使用以下命令来连接WiFi网络:
    “`
    sudo nmcli device wifi connect password
    “`
    其中,是WiFi网络的名称(SSID),是WiFi网络的密码。

    连接成功后,会显示连接的信息。

    2. CentOS或RHEL系统:
    打开终端,并输入以下命令来查看可用的无线网络列表:
    “`
    sudo iwlist scan
    “`

    在列表中找到你要连接的WiFi网络的名称(SSID)。

    然后,使用以下命令来连接WiFi网络:
    “`
    sudo nmcli device wifi connect password
    “`
    其中,是WiFi网络的名称(SSID),是WiFi网络的密码。

    连接成功后,会显示连接的信息。

    3. Arch Linux系统:
    打开终端,并输入以下命令来查看可用的无线网络列表:
    “`
    sudo iwlist scan
    “`

    在列表中找到你要连接的WiFi网络的名称(SSID)。

    然后,使用以下命令来连接WiFi网络:
    “`
    sudo netctl start <配置文件名>
    “`
    其中,<配置文件名>是WiFi网络的配置文件名。

    连接成功后,会显示连接的信息。

    4. Fedora系统:
    打开终端,并输入以下命令来查看可用的无线网络列表:
    “`
    sudo iwlist scan
    “`

    在列表中找到你要连接的WiFi网络的名称(SSID)。

    然后,使用以下命令来连接WiFi网络:
    “`
    sudo nmcli device wifi connect password
    “`
    其中,是WiFi网络的名称(SSID),是WiFi网络的密码。

    连接成功后,会显示连接的信息。

    5. OpenSUSE系统:
    打开终端,并输入以下命令来查看可用的无线网络列表:
    “`
    sudo iwlist scan
    “`

    在列表中找到你要连接的WiFi网络的名称(SSID)。

    然后,使用以下命令来连接WiFi网络:
    “`
    sudo nmcli device wifi connect password
    “`
    其中,是WiFi网络的名称(SSID),是WiFi网络的密码。

    连接成功后,会显示连接的信息。

    以上是在不同的Linux发行版中连接WiFi网络的一些基本命令行方法。根据具体的发行版和网络环境的不同,有可能会有一些差异,所以请在操作前,先查阅相关的官方文档或参考手册。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用命令行来连接WiFi网络。下面是具体的操作流程:

    1. 确认无线网卡信息
    首先,需要确认系统上已经安装了无线网卡并且驱动已经加载。可以使用以下命令来列出所有的网络接口信息:
    “`
    ifconfig -a
    “`
    查找类似于”wlan0″或者”wlp2s0″等无线网卡的名称。

    2. 扫描可用的WiFi网络
    运行以下命令来扫描可用的WiFi网络:
    “`
    sudo iwlist wlan0 scan
    “`
    将命令中的”wlan0″换成你的无线网卡名称。

    3. 创建WiFi配置文件
    使用以下命令创建一个WiFi配置文件(例如,名为”wifi.conf”):
    “`
    sudo nano /etc/wpa_supplicant/wifi.conf
    “`
    在打开的文件中,添加以下内容:
    “`
    network={
    ssid=”your_wifi_ssid”
    psk=”your_wifi_password”
    }
    “`
    将”your_wifi_ssid”替换为你的WiFi网络的名称,将”your_wifi_password”替换为WiFi网络的密码。

    保存并关闭文件。

    4. 连接WiFi网络
    运行以下命令来连接WiFi网络:
    “`
    sudo wpa_supplicant -B -iwlan0 -c/etc/wpa_supplicant/wifi.conf
    “`
    将命令中的”wlan0″换成你的无线网卡名称。

    5. 获取IP地址
    最后,运行以下命令来获取IP地址:
    “`
    sudo dhclient wlan0
    “`
    将命令中的”wlan0″换成你的无线网卡名称。

    这样,你的Linux系统就可以通过命令行连接WiFi网络了。

    注意:以上步骤假设你的无线网络使用的是WPA或WPA2加密方式,如果你的无线网络使用其他加密方式,则需要相应地修改配置文件。此外,不同的Linux发行版可能会有细微差别,所以请根据你所使用的发行版进行相应的修改。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部